A Little Left of Center:
Wading Through the Mind of Your Friendly Neighborhood Psychiatrist
A Little Left of Center is a revelatory psychology memoir that combines science and conscience through the telling of stories, prescriptions, and precisely weaponized conversation. Written through the perspective of Dr. Weinberg, your friendly neighborhood psychiatrist, we reveal the truth of living as a medical doctor and a human—at the same time. It turns out that patients aren’t the only ones in the psych wards trudging through mountains of biases and assumptions.
Each chapter takes us on a provocative journey with a different mental disease through real-life patient experiences. In this book, we’re shown what the front line of mental health really looks like, and the daily struggles of people clawing their way to wellness. Some of the diseases we explore are obsessive-compulsive disorder, sexual dysfunction, post-traumatic stress disorder, and everyone’s favorite frightening diagnosis: sociopathy. (Stay tuned for a rare and infinitely interesting intersection of Dr. Weinberg’s creation and a run-in with that very same affliction.)
Together, we challenge stigmas, enlighten our readers with captivating first-hand experiences, and offer hope and guidance to those struggling with mental health as well.
